#4daffd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4daffd is composed of 30.2% red, 68.6%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 206.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 64.7%. #4daffd color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#005ffb.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#4daffd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4daffd has RGB values of R:77, G:175,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 5091325.

Shades and Tints of #4daffd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000910 is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4daffd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a6aa is the less saturated color, while #4daffd is the most saturated one.
